SPED 3100 - Integrated Partial Practicum (IPP)


4 cr. 4 hr. Offered every Semester

This field experience begins to fulfill the Massachusetts Department of Elementary and Secondary Education’s hours required for a Teacher of Students with Moderate Disabilities Grades PreK-8 License and for a Teacher of Elementary Students Grades 1-6 License. Teacher candidates spend half the semester, four days a week from 8:30 to 11:30 or the equivalent, in a fully integrated classroom, a resource room, or a self-contained classroom, and the other half of the semester in an elementary classroom where students with disabilities are fully integrated or included in the classroom. Teacher candidates design lessons that meet the learning needs of the students, and then implement and evaluate these lessons. The practicum experience begins with an observation period during which teacher candidates observe the supervising practitioner, become familiar with the students and classroom routines, and assist the supervising practitioner as needed. Then, the teacher candidates systematically assume increasing responsibility in the classroom which culminates in their design, implementation, and evaluation of lessons that address the learning needs of the students with whom the candidates work. This course is taken concurrently with SPED 2970 , SPED 3720  or SPED 3510 , EDUC 3122   and SPED 4300 . Required for all Special Education: Moderate Disabilities PreK-8 Majors.

Prerequisite(s): Successful passage of Stage One Education Unit Review and all concentration-required MTELs.
